British PM announces six-point action plan to defeat Putin
Forming an international coalition to provide humanitarian assistance to Ukraine, supporting Ukraine's self-defense, maximizing economic pressure on Russia, preventing a "creeping normalization" of Russia's actions in Ukraine, diplomatic ways of de-escalation with the full participation of Kyiv and the rapid strengthening of security in the Euro-Atlantic region, such a plan of the six points for defeating Putin in his aggression against Ukraine was announced by British Prime Minister Boris Johnson.
"Putin must fail. We must come together under a six point plan of action to ensure Putin fails in his ambitions," the head of the British government said on Twitter on Sunday.
"The world is watching. It is not future historians but the people of Ukraine who will be our judge," Johnson said.
